Hooks That Stop the Scroll

On LinkedIn, the first two lines determine whether someone reads your post or keeps scrolling. The platform shows only the opening lines before hiding the rest behind a 'see more' button. Your hook needs to earn that click.

Effective hook strategies include:

  • Starting with a surprising or counterintuitive statement: 'I turned down a $500K deal last month. Here is why.'
  • Asking a question your audience genuinely cares about: 'What is the one skill nobody teaches in B2B sales?'
  • Leading with a specific number or result: '37% of our leads now come from a single LinkedIn post format.'
  • Creating a knowledge gap: 'Most founders make this mistake with their LinkedIn content. Are you one of them?'

Post Formats That Drive Engagement

Not all post formats perform equally on LinkedIn. Some formats consistently outperform others because they align with how professionals consume content on the platform. Understanding these formats helps you diversify your content mix and keep your audience engaged over time.

Listicle posts (such as '7 things I learned' or '5 tools I use daily') perform well because they promise specific, scannable value. Personal story posts build trust and relatability by showing the human side of your professional life. How-to posts attract saves and shares because they offer actionable advice people want to reference later.

Calls to Action That Actually Convert

A strong post without a clear call to action is a missed opportunity. The best LinkedIn CTAs feel natural rather than pushy. They guide the reader toward a logical next step based on the value you just delivered.

For engagement posts, ask a specific question that invites comments. For lead generation posts, offer a resource in exchange for a comment or DM. For brand awareness posts, encourage sharing by framing the content as something the reader's network would benefit from.

Building a Personal Brand Through Consistent Content

Personal branding on LinkedIn is not about self-promotion. It is about becoming the person your audience thinks of first when they face a problem you can solve. This happens through consistent, valuable content that demonstrates your expertise and perspective over weeks and months.

The compounding effect is real. Each post introduces you to new connections, reinforces your expertise with existing ones, and builds a library of content that works for you long after it is published. Over time, this creates inbound opportunities that no amount of cold outreach can match.

What makes a LinkedIn post engaging?

Engaging LinkedIn posts share three qualities: a strong opening hook that stops the scroll, genuine value in the body through insights, data, or personal experience, and a clear call to action at the end. Formatting also matters: short paragraphs, white space, and a conversational tone all contribute to higher engagement rates.

How do I write a good hook for a LinkedIn post?

Effective hooks create curiosity, challenge assumptions, or promise specific value. Examples include opening with a surprising statistic, asking a thought-provoking question, or making a bold statement that your audience cares about. The first two lines are critical because LinkedIn truncates posts behind a 'see more' link.

What post formats work best on LinkedIn?

Several formats consistently perform well: listicle posts with numbered tips, personal story posts that share lessons learned, contrarian take posts that challenge industry norms, and how-to posts that provide step-by-step guidance. Carousel documents and short text posts with a clear narrative also tend to generate strong engagement.

How often should I create new LinkedIn content?

For meaningful growth, aim for three to five posts per week. This frequency keeps you visible in your network's feed without requiring an unsustainable time commitment. Quality should always take priority over quantity, but consistency is what drives long-term audience growth.
